How we see relies on the transfer of light. Light go through the front of the eye (cornea) to the lens. The cornea and the lens assistance to concentrate the light rays onto the back of the eye (retina). The cells in the retina soak up and transform the light to electrochemical impulses which are transferred along the optic nerve and afterwards to the brain.

The shutter of a cam can shut or open up relying on the amount of light required to reveal the movie in the rear of the camera. The eye, like the camera shutter, runs in the same way. The iris and the pupil control exactly how much light to allow right into the back of the eye.


The lens of a video camera is able to concentrate on items far and up close with the aid of mirrors and various other mechanical gadgets. The lens of the eye aids us to concentrate but sometimes needs some added help in order to concentrate plainly. Glasses, call lenses, and fabricated lenses all aid us to see more clearly.
